[Webkit-unassigned] [Bug 209905] New: REGRESSION: (259383) [ Mac and iOS wk2 ] WebKit::ServiceWorkerFetchTask::didNotHandle crash on http/tests/workers/service/basic-timeout.https.html

bugzilla-daemon at webkit.org bugzilla-daemon at webkit.org
Thu Apr 2 08:01:33 PDT 2020


https://bugs.webkit.org/show_bug.cgi?id=209905

            Bug ID: 209905
           Summary: REGRESSION: (259383) [ Mac and iOS wk2 ]
                    WebKit::ServiceWorkerFetchTask::didNotHandle crash on
                    http/tests/workers/service/basic-timeout.https.html
           Product: WebKit
           Version: WebKit Nightly Build
          Hardware: Macintosh
                OS: macOS 10.15
            Status: NEW
          Severity: Normal
          Priority: P2
         Component: Service Workers
          Assignee: webkit-unassigned at lists.webkit.org
          Reporter: Lawrence.j at apple.com

Created attachment 395266

  --> https://bugs.webkit.org/attachment.cgi?id=395266&action=review

basic-timeout.https-crash-log

http/tests/workers/service/basic-timeout.https.html

Description:
This test is crashing on Mac wk2 and iOS wk2. The test regressed today, looks related to r259383.

History:
https://results.webkit.org/?suite=layout-tests&test=http%2Ftests%2Fworkers%2Fservice%2Fbasic-timeout.https.html&flavor=wk2&platform=ios&platform=mac

Crash log attached;
Thread 0 Crashed:: Dispatch queue: com.apple.main-thread
0   com.apple.WebKit                    0x000000010256d47e WebKit::ServiceWorkerFetchTask::didNotHandle() + 30 (ServiceWorkerFetchTask.cpp:203)
1   com.apple.WebKit                    0x00000001026a42f4 void IPC::callMemberFunctionImpl<WebKit::ServiceWorkerFetchTask, void (WebKit::ServiceWorkerFetchTask::*)(), std::__1::tuple<> >(WebKit::ServiceWorkerFetchTask*, void (WebKit::ServiceWorkerFetchTask::*)(), std::__1::tuple<>&&, std::__1::integer_sequence<unsigned long>) + 132 (HandleMessage.h:42)
2   com.apple.WebKit                    0x00000001026a4260 void IPC::callMemberFunction<WebKit::ServiceWorkerFetchTask, void (WebKit::ServiceWorkerFetchTask::*)(), std::__1::tuple<>, std::__1::integer_sequence<unsigned long> >(std::__1::tuple<>&&, WebKit::ServiceWorkerFetchTask*, void (WebKit::ServiceWorkerFetchTask::*)()) + 112 (HandleMessage.h:48)
3   com.apple.WebKit                    0x000000010264e1c6 void IPC::handleMessage<Messages::ServiceWorkerFetchTask::DidNotHandle, WebKit::ServiceWorkerFetchTask, void (WebKit::ServiceWorkerFetchTask::*)()>(IPC::Decoder&, WebKit::ServiceWorkerFetchTask*, void (WebKit::ServiceWorkerFetchTask::*)()) + 150 (HandleMessage.h:115)
4   com.apple.WebKit                    0x000000010264dd25 WebKit::ServiceWorkerFetchTask::didReceiveMessage(IPC::Connection&, IPC::Decoder&) + 133 (ServiceWorkerFetchTaskMessageReceiver.cpp:47)
5   com.apple.WebKit                    0x0000000103d47dae WebKit::WebSWServerToContextConnection::didReceiveFetchTaskMessage(IPC::Connection&, IPC::Decoder&) + 238 (WebSWServerToContextConnection.cpp:147)
6   com.apple.WebKit                    0x000000010279f049 WebKit::NetworkConnectionToWebProcess::didReceiveMessage(IPC::Connection&, IPC::Decoder&) + 2073 (NetworkConnectionToWebProcess.cpp:249)
7   com.apple.WebKit                    0x0000000102258269 IPC::Connection::dispatchMessage(IPC::Decoder&) + 473 (Connection.cpp:1009)
8   com.apple.WebKit                    0x0000000102258bc2 IPC::Connection::dispatchMessage(std::__1::unique_ptr<IPC::Decoder, std::__1::default_delete<IPC::Decoder> >) + 578
9   com.apple.WebKit                    0x00000001022592a0 IPC::Connection::dispatchOneIncomingMessage() + 208 (Connection.cpp:1146)
10  com.apple.WebKit                    0x0000000102277f0e IPC::Connection::enqueueIncomingMessage(std::__1::unique_ptr<IPC::Decoder, std::__1::default_delete<IPC::Decoder> >)::$_7::operator()() + 94 (Connection.cpp:986)
11  com.apple.WebKit                    0x0000000102277e1e WTF::Detail::CallableWrapper<IPC::Connection::enqueueIncomingMessage(std::__1::unique_ptr<IPC::Decoder, std::__1::default_delete<IPC::Decoder> >)::$_7, void>::call() + 30 (Function.h:52)

-- 
You are receiving this mail because:
You are the assignee for the bug.
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.webkit.org/pipermail/webkit-unassigned/attachments/20200402/62feb2e3/attachment.htm>


More information about the webkit-unassigned mailing list